50594805 has 24 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 92857752. Its totient is φ = 25396224.
The previous prime is 50594783. The next prime is 50594833. The reversal of 50594805 is 50849505.
It is a happy number.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 4 ways, for example, as 18173169 + 32421636 = 4263^2 + 5694^2 .
It is not a de Polignac number, because 50594805 - 25 = 50594773 is a prime.
It is a self number, because there is not a number n which added to its sum of digits gives 50594805.
It is a congruent number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(11)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 23 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 32304 + ... + 33833.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(3869073).
Almost surely, 250594805 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
50594805 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(42262947).
50594805 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
50594805 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 66165 (or 66162 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 36000, while the sum is 36.
The square root of 50594805 is about 7113.0025305774. The cubic root of 50594805 is about 369.8582485978.
Subtracting from 50594805 its sum of digits (36), we obtain a square (50594769 = 71132).
The spelling of 50594805 in words is "fifty million, five hundred ninety-four thousand, eight hundred five".
